Komodo Islands
The Komodo Islands are generally safe for travelers, but the remote marine environment and presence of Komodo dragons demand respect. Strong ocean currents at dive sites are the primary risk. Always use licensed guides in the national park โ it is mandatory and enforced.
Surabaya
Surabaya is generally safe for tourists โ a working industrial port city rather than a tourism honeypot, so tourist scams are rare. Real concerns are dense traffic and motorbike accidents, opportunistic phone snatches in crowded markets, and Bromo or Ijen volcano gas exposure on the overnight trips. Late-night solo walks in Sunan Ampel and Bubutan are best avoided.

Komodo Islands
Komodo has a tropical savanna climate, drier and hotter than most of Indonesia. The dry season (April-November) brings calm seas and clear skies ideal for diving and trekking. The wet season (December-March) has rougher seas and afternoon storms but greener landscapes.
Surabaya
Surabaya has a tropical monsoon climate with two distinct seasons โ dry from April to October and wet from November to March. Temperatures stay hot year-round (28-33ยฐC); humidity hovers at 75-85%. The city sits at sea level on Java's flat northern coast and gets noticeably hotter than highland Bandung or Yogyakarta.

Komodo Islands
Komodo National Park is entirely boat-accessed from Labuan Bajo, a small harbor town on western Flores. There are no roads or public transport between the islands. All exploration happens by boat โ day trips, multi-day liveaboards, or private charters.
Walkability: Labuan Bajo town is small and walkable along the main harbor road. Within the national park, guided walking trails on Komodo and Rinca islands are 1-4 km. Padar Island has a single steep hiking trail. No roads exist on any park island.
Surabaya
Surabaya has the Suroboyo Bus rapid transit system (5 routes, IDR 0 if you pay with empty plastic bottles, 100% recyclable bottle fare) and dozens of Damri and Trans Sidoarjo bus lines, but most travellers rely on Grab and Gojek for everything. Traffic is heavy 07:00-09:00 and 16:00-19:00. The city has no metro yet; an MRT is planned for 2030.
Walkability: Surabaya is not a walking city โ wide boulevards, no shade and dense traffic make most distances feel longer than they are. The Tunjungan, Embong Malang and Genteng areas of central Surabaya have improved sidewalks since 2018; the Sunan Ampel and Tugu Pahlawan areas are walkable in compact 20-30 minute loops. For most other neighbourhoods, a Grab is the practical choice.

How long is the flight from Komodo Islands to Surabaya?
Roughly 1h 28m on a direct flight (about 751 km / 466 mi). One-way fares typically run $120-350 depending on season and how far in advance you book.
How do daily costs in Komodo Islands and Surabaya compare?
In Komodo Islands: budget ~$40-80/day, mid-range ~$120-250/day, luxury ~$400+/day. In Surabaya: budget ~$22-40/day, mid-range ~$60-110/day, luxury ~$200+/day.
